About the role

The Maintenance Technician II plays a key role in keeping our agricultural production facility running safely and efficiently by troubleshooting, repairing, and maintaining processing, packaging, material handling, and robotic systems. This hands-on position supports equipment such as conveyors, hammer mills, sifters, Allen-Bradley PLCs, and automated production equipment to minimize downtime and maximize operational performance. We're looking for a mechanically inclined problem solver who enjoys diagnosing equipment issues, performing preventative maintenance, and working with both electrical and automation systems in a fast-paced environment. Responsibilities

  • Install, maintain, and overhaul production machines and facility equipment.
  • Provide emergency/unscheduled repairs of production equipment and/or mobile equipment and vehicles, and perform scheduled maintenance repairs during service.
  • Perform mechanic skills including mechanical, electrical, pneumatic, hydraulic, troubleshooting, and repair of production machines.
  • Read and interpret equipment manuals, blueprints, and work orders to perform required maintenance and service.
  • Diagnose problems, replace or repair parts, test, and make adjustments.
  • Perform regular preventive maintenance on machines, equipment, and plant facilities.
  • Maintain computerized preventative maintenance system.
  • Maintain current and in-depth knowledge of all safety policies and standards related to position. Work in a safe manner and recognize unsafe situations, taking appropriate action to ensure safety of self and others in the building.

Physical Requirements and Working Environment

  • Must be able to stand/sit for an extended period of time.
  • Ability to frequently lift/push/pull up to 60 pounds.
  • Must be able to climb/stoop/kneel at heights up to 100 feet.
  • Works indoors and outdoors in varying weather conditions and temperatures.
  • Working conditions could include: dust, fumes, moderate noise, and uneven surfaces.
